Vernon, NY — Chapvious (Leon Bailey) captured the $7,500 featured trot on Friday (June 26) at Vernon Downs.
Lous Lancelot (James Lackey) led to the quarter in :27.4. He slowed things down with a :30.3 second quarter and was first to the half in :58.2. Tiktok Roy (Jimmy Whittemore) was first to make a move, going first-over heading around the final turn, and was first to three-quarters in 1:27.2.
As they reached the stretch, Chapvious ($4.30) joined second-place finisher Tiktok Roy as they battled down the stretch. Chapvious used a late lunge to claim the win in 1:56.4. Lous Lancelot had to settle for third.

Chapvious is a 4-year-old mare by Devious Man owned by Purple Haze Stables and trained by George Ducharme. It was her third win this season. She now has seven career victories.
Jimmy Whittemore had a driving hat trick. Truman Gale and Chris Long had driving doubles. George Ducharme had a training double.
